Key Factors Making Insurance in California Unique
Several elements influence the insurance landscape for renewable energy projects in California:
- Climate Risks: Wildfires, earthquakes, and storms pose significant threats.
- Regulatory Environment: State policies favor renewable energy but require stringent compliance.
- Market Dynamics: Competition and fluctuating policies can impact project viability.
- Technology Complexity: The integration of innovative technologies necessitates specialized coverage.
Understanding these factors helps tailor your insurance strategy to protect your investments effectively.

1. Choosing the Right Coverage Options
In California, renewable energy ventures demand specialized policies tailored to the sector’s unique risks. Some crucial coverage options include:
- Property and Equipment Insurance: Protects turbines, solar panels, batteries, and infrastructure.
- Business Interruption Insurance: Covers income loss due to project delays or damages.
- Liability Insurance: Shields against third-party claims related to environmental impact or accidents.
- Environmental Impairment Liability: Addresses risks of environmental damage, a concern in eco-sensitive areas.
- Construction All Risks (CAR): Ensures coverage during the building phase, including equipment and contractor-related risks.
For comprehensive protection, consider combining these options into a custom insurance package suited to your project’s scope.

3. Regulatory Compliance and Insurance in California
California’s regulatory framework places significant emphasis on insurance requirements for renewable projects. Notably:
- Permitting processes often require proof of adequate insurance coverage.
- Environmental regulations necessitate coverage for special risks.
- Financial assurance may be mandated for large-scale projects to demonstrate funding for potential damages or decommissioning.
Partnering with insurers familiar with California’s compliance landscape ensures your project meets all legal requirements, reducing administrative hurdles and delays.
Choosing the Best Insurance Policies for California Renewable Energy Projects
Knowing what policies to prioritize can streamline your coverage selection process. Let's review some of the top insurance policies that are essential for California projects.
| Policy Type | Purpose | Key Benefits |
|---|---|---|
| Property & Equipment Insurance | Protects physical assets | Coverage against damage, theft, or natural disasters |
| Construction All Risks (CAR) | Safeguards during project development | Covers construction-related damages and coverage for contractors |
| Environmental Liability | Addresses environmental risks | Protects against pollution, contamination, and regulatory fines |
| Business Interruption | Ensures income continuity | Compensation for lost revenue during outages |
| General & Product Liability | Covers third-party claims | Environmental incidents, accidents, or injuries lead to legal costs |
Selecting a combination of these policies based on your project specifics ensures holistic protection—a cornerstone of effective project risk management.
